Moravagine est une Åuvre monumentale de la littérature moderniste, un récit d'une intensité rare qui explore les confins de la raison et de la barbarie. Le roman suit l'odyssée d'un médecin qui libère son patient, Moravagine, dernier descendant d'une lignée royale dégénérée et tueur impulsif. Ensemble, ils se lancent dans une course effrénée à travers le monde, participant aux soulèvements de la Révolution russe et explorant les profondeurs de l'Amazonie.
Blaise Cendrars livre ici une méditation sauvage sur le nihilisme et la décomposition de la vieille Europe. À travers le personnage de Moravagine, Ãatre amoral et destructeur, l'auteur interroge la nature de la violence et l'attrait du chaos dans un monde en pleine désintégration. Ce récit de voyage, à la fois physique et psychologique, se distingue par son style nerveux et ses images saisissantes. Véritable jalon de l'avant-garde, Moravagine est une plongée fascinante dans les ténèbres de l'âme humaine et un portrait sans concession des turbulences du début du XXe siècle.
